Most purulent maxillofacial infections are of odontogenic origin. Treatment of infection includes the surgical intervention, such as incision and drainage, and adjunctive treatment. The use of high-dose antibiotics is also indicated. The choice of an antibiotics should be based on the knowledge of the usual causative microbes and the results of antibacterial sensitivity test. We have undertaken clinical studies on 119 patients in Dept. of Oral and Maxillofacial Surgery, Inha University Hospital from January 2000 to December 2007. Many anaerobic microbes are killed quickly when exposed to oxygen. Thus the needle aspiration techniques and the transfer under inert gas were used when culturing. The aim of this study was to obtain informations for the bacteriologic features and the effective antimicrobial therapy against maxillofaical odontogenic infections. The obtained results were as follows: 1. The most frequent causes of infections were odontogenic (88.3%), and in odontogenic cause, pulpal infections were the most common causes(53.8%). 2. The buccal and submandibular spaces (respectively 23.5%) were the most frequent involved fascial spaces, followed by masticator spaces (14.3%). 3. The most common underlying medical problems were diabetes (17.6%), however the relation with prognosis was not discovered. 4. The complications were the expiry, mediastinitis, necrotizing fasciitis, orbital abscess, and osteomyelitis. 5. The most common admission periods were 1-2 weeks, and the most patients were discharged within 3 weeks. However, patients who admitted over 5 weeks were about 10%. 6. A total of 99 bacterial strains (1.1 strains per abscess) was isolated from 93 patients (78.2%). The most common bacterium isolated was Streptococcus viridans (46.2%), followed by $\beta$-hemolytic group streptococcus (10.1%). 7. Penicillins (penicillin G 58.3%, oxacillin 80.0%, ampicillin 80.0%) have slightly lower sensitivity. Thus we recommend the antibiotics, such as glycopeptides (teicoplanin 100%, vancomycin 100%) and quinolones (ciprofloxacin 90.0%) which have high susceptibility in cases in which peni cillin therapy failed or severe infections.

The purpose of this study was to review the government's policy on the enhancement of sports facilities for community residents regarding the lack of knowledge surrounding the infrastructure of sports facilities. The government has invested approximately 2.4 trillion won to establish 220 community sports centers, 385 billion won for 194 multi-purpose indoor centers, and 1.3 trillion won for rebuilding 1,870 school outdoor fields. On the other hand, there are problems with the link between the crumb rubber infill on sports fields and cancer, a lack of availability of indoor sports centers, and an increased federal budget deficit. It is the responsibility of government to plan and construct outdoor fields that are large enough to accommodate all people and allow them to play activities. In addition, the guidelines should ensure that the indoor space required for physical activities at each teaching station is large enough to accommodate all students in the class and handle two classes. The government should suggest the federal government guidelines based on a good understanding of the concept of infrastructure in sports facilities. The government also should make efforts to reduce the regulatory powers and provide the community with an autonomous right to plan and construct sports facilities.

This paper describes a methodology for shape design using an optimal design system, whereas generally a three dimensional analysis is required for such designs. An automatic finite element mesh generation technique, which is based on fuzzy knowledge processing and computational geometry techniques, is incorporated into the system, together with a commercial FE analysis code and a commercial solid modeler. Also, with the aid of multilayer neural networks, the present system allows us to automatically obtain a design window, in which a number of satisfactory design solutions exist in a multi-dimensional design parameter space. The developed optimal design system is successfully applied to evaluate the structures that are used. This study used a stress gauge to measure the maximum stress affecting the parts of the side housing bracket which are most vulnerable to cracking. Thereafter, we used a tool to interpret the maximum stress value, while maintaining the same stress as that exerted on the spot. Furthermore, a stress analysis was performed with the typical shape maintained intact, SM490 used for the material and the minimizing weight safety coefficient set to 3, while keeping the maximum stress the same as or smaller than the allowable stress. In this paper, a side housing bracket with a comparably simple structure for 36 tons was optimized, however if the method developed in this study were applied to side housing brackets of different classes (tons), their quality would be greatly improved.

One of the major goals in high school Informatics is for students to develop creative problem-solving abilities based on knowledge on computer science. Thus, the contents of the textbooks should be accurate and appropriate. However, we discovered that the current Informatics textbooks contain the untrue and/or inappropriate descriptions of main memory and virtual memory. The textbooks describe that main memory is composed of RAM and ROM. The virtual memory is described as a technique in which a part of the secondary storage is utilized as main memory to execute an application of which size is larger than that of main memory. In this study, we attempted to uncover the root causes of the fallacies, and suggest the accurate explanations by comparing with renowned books adopted in most schools worldwide including USA. Our study reveals that it is inappropriate to include ROM in main memory from the memory hierarchy perspective. Virtual memory is a technique that provides convenience to programmers, through which an operating system loads the necessary portion of a program from secondary storage to main memory. As for the advantages of virtual memory in the current computer systems, the focus should be on providing the effective multitasking capability, rather than on executing a larger program than the size of main memory. We suggest that it is appropriate to exclude virtual memory in textbooks considering its complexity.

The purpose of the study was to compare science curriculum documents of the several countries including Korea, the United States, the United Kingdom, Japan, and Singapore. The comparison focused on goals and contents in science education of each country. The goals for science education in each country were very similar. They included understanding knowledge, acquiring inquiry skills, developing positive attitudes towards science, and appreciating S-T-S in most countries. But each country's goal setting level was different; some countries set the same goals for several grades and other countries set different goals for each grade. Goals provided for each grade were more specific and elaborated. Science contents were categorized differently in each country. In Korea, science contents were categorized in energy, matter, living things, and earth. On the other hand, science contents were composed of 8 categories including unifying concepts and processes in science, science as inquiry, physical science, life science, earth and space science, science and technology, science in personal and social perspectives, and history and nature of science in the United States. In the United Kingdom, science enquiry, life processes and living things, materials and their properties, and physical process were categories for science contents. In Singapore, science contents were organized by themes relevant to students' everyday experience. Implications for goals and contents in science education to prepare students to live and work in a future society were suggested based on the results of the study.

Looking at multimedia education contents from a design point of view, the instructor's design model may differ from the child's understanding model due to gap of the instructor's and child's knowledge. This fact implies it impacts the effectiveness of the education contents. The learning efficiency of Korean typography in WBI for children depends on the font-family, line space, font-size, the age of user, the output device such as the monitor, and other various factors. In this paper, we measured and analyzed on readability of Korean typography in WBI for children by reading speed method. The results of experiments show that readability depends on the font-family of typography, age(grade), and sex of children. In detail, "Goolymche" has the shortest time to be read, and girl and the highest grade students of elementary school have shorter time than boy and the lower grade students. Moreover, we consider the elegance of typography in WBI for holding children's interests because they prefer "Yopseoche". We provide some CSSs in WBI for children based on the experimental results, to used in school fields.
